Transaction 2c21014ac830e3cbda021a2a9fad76d9fe92a385f81feb146993d1929452de7a
1 Input
1 Output
-
2c21014ac830e3cbda021a2a9fad76d9fe92a385f81feb146993d1929452de7a:0
- value
- 285217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 652a8e16ef45e77ab766844f3ec76593d6766e60 OP_EQUAL
- address
- 3Auw9hERz18vEHy4b7QX2hxtmu1XopGLV9